MPP calls for Ibobi’s resignation

IMPHAL, Oct 29: The Manipur People’s Party (MPP) has demanded the Chief Minister O. Ibobi to resign on moral ground for failing to maintain proper law and order situation in the state.

Speaking to mediapersons at the sideline of sit-in-protest demonstration held against the killing of Thokchom Sanayamba, the president of MPP, Dr. Nimaichand Luwang stated that the SPF government has failed to protect the life and property of the people and it has created a ‘reign of terror’ in the whole state. The recent killing of Zilla Parishad member Thokchom Sanayamba by some unidentified persons is a clear example of the vulnerability of the elected representatives of local bodies of the state. The elected representatives of Gram Panchayat and Zilla Parishad have been repeatedly demanding the state government to provide adequate security but their demands have never been considered by the government and as a result they have become soft targets of so many organizations, he said.

Nimaichand further mentioned that the state government has created a disparity in the functioning of the ADCs and other local bodies like Panchayat and Municipality. The members of ADCs have been provided adequate security following threats and intimidations from some organizations and also ample amount of autonomy has been granted to them under the devolution of power. On the other hand, the local bodies of Panchayat and Municipality have been lagging behind in all aspects as a result of this disparity, he added.
